The Advancement of Switch Backlighting Technology



As innovation progressed, the evolution of button backlighting ended up being a key consider improving customer experience and performance. Backlighting was limited to basic lighting, mostly using incandescent light bulbs. These early systems mishandled and provided very little design flexibility. With the arrival of LED technology, backlighting transformed significantly, giving brighter, more energy-efficient choices that permitted vibrant results and diverse shades.


Makers began including personalized RGB illumination, making it possible for users to individualize their tools. This shift not only enhanced aesthetic appeals yet additionally facilitated much better functionality, as backlit buttons came to be easier to locate in dimly lit settings. Advanced features such as flexible brightness and programmable lighting patterns emerged, enhancing the general interaction with gadgets.


This evolution mirrored an expanding understanding of the value of user engagement and accessibility, noting a crucial change in how backlighting is incorporated into modern-day innovation.

Practical Applications Across Devices



How do different gadgets take advantage of switch backlighting? In contemporary innovation, button backlighting serves necessary duties throughout numerous tools. In laptop computers and computer systems, brightened tricks improve typing precision in low-light settings, making it possible for customers to preserve efficiency without straining site web their eyes. Pc gaming consoles make use of backlighting to improve gameplay experiences by supplying aesthetic cues, which can be important throughout extreme gaming sessions.


Mobile phones and tablet computers frequently include backlit switches, ensuring that individuals can browse interfaces effortlessly, despite ambient lights problems. Home devices, such as microwaves or washing machines, likewise take advantage of backlighting to show functional standing plainly, decreasing the probability of individual mistake. In addition, automotive applications utilize backlit controls for dashboard instruments, assisting in more secure driving by boosting presence. On the whole, Switch backlighting is a sensible attribute that greatly improves user interaction and security across a variety of devices.

Are There Different Types of Backlighting Technologies?



Yes, there are numerous sorts of backlighting technologies, including LED, OLED, and electroluminescent. Each deals distinctive benefits concerning brightness, power efficiency, and color precision, dealing with various user preferences and device needs.

What Materials Are Commonly Used for Backlighting Switches?



Common products for backlighting switches consist of LED lights, polycarbonate or acrylic diffusers, and various metal or plastic real estates. These elements collaborate to boost presence while making sure longevity and capability in different applications.




How Do Different Shades of Backlighting Affect Functionality?



Different shades of backlighting boost functionality by improving exposure and differentiating functions. Red typically indicates warnings, while green indicates energetic status; as a result, users can quickly translate details and react efficiently in various atmospheres.
